The Gangnam Job & Startup Hub Center held its first Demo Day of 2025 at the COEX Startup Branch. The event showcased the impressive progress of 12 early-stage startups participating in the center’s incubation program. The Gangnam Job & Startup Hub Center is renowned for providing tailored acceleration programs, office space, investment opportunities, and crucial networking for burgeoning companies.
Team W has developed AndOrder, a smart ordering service designed for smart stadiums. The platform enables easy food ordering and payment in crowded venues like baseball stadiums, targeting locations that customers don’t visit frequently but where convenience is crucial.
Hitit Soft presented Maderr, a cloud-based, AI no-code SaaS platform. This tool empowers small and medium-sized businesses by facilitating their digital transformation.
Link Connection showcased its MSO (Management Service Organization) solutions. Leveraging hospital patient and operational data, the company provides essential branding and marketing services to healthcare providers in an increasingly competitive sector.
Moable highlighted its AI-powered residential space management services, including GoChongmu for civil complaint and contract management, and Repair24, a comprehensive maintenance solution.
FinderGap unveiled Korea’s first bug bounty platform, offering robust cybersecurity solutions. This platform proactively defends against hacking, addresses vulnerabilities, and provides continuous security management.
Do Labs introduced iBelieve, a smartphone management solution aimed at helping parents and children navigate digital usage, fostering healthy independent digital habits in children.
Pai Media Lab demonstrated its AI on-device safety control solutions. Their core technology precisely tracks workers, vehicles, and robots within 10cm accuracy without sensors, while also detecting potential hazards in real-time.
LRHR presented fapis, a luxury resale platform built on extensive luxury item repair expertise. Beyond typical resale, Papis innovatively restores B-grade luxury goods to S-grade quality through a “repair-to-sell” model, offering them at attractive prices.
New Look launched Makgeolli Seltzer, an RTD (Ready-to-Drink) alcoholic beverage that reimagines traditional Korean rice wine. Following success with zero-alcohol makgeolli in Korea, the company is now making inroads into the wellness F&B market in New York.
The Highway introduced All Day Find Me, a probiotic product specifically formulated to improve cognitive function.
The demo day also featured presentations from Quattro Labs, which provides Papaya 365, a data settlement SaaS platform for gig worker B2B2C channel operators, and Eleven Liter, which operates Lifepet, an AI home care solution for progressive diseases in companion animals.
